48 New Suites, Children's Pool with Splash Pad, and Renovations to All Existing Suites Highlight Black Oak Casino Resort's Continued Dedication to Creating the Ultimate Family Destination in Central California

TUOLUMNE, Calif., May 7, 2024 /PRNewswire/ -- As part of a sustained effort to provide families in Tuolumne County and beyond with a vacation destination that offers memorable entertainment options to guests of all ages, Black Oak Casino Resort is pleased to announce the details of a major renovation and expansion project at THE HOTEL. On track for a summer 2025 completion date, this substantial update includes the addition of 48 brand-new suites, a complete overhaul of the existing 148 rooms, an updated hotel exterior, and the construction of two all-new aquatic facilities.

Black Oak Casino Resort is owned and operated by the Tuolumne Band of Me-Wuk Indians who are dedicated to creating a wholesome, family experience for the Tuolumne community. Moorefield Construction, Inc. was awarded the bid for this expansion and has a well-documented history of creating some of California's most iconic buildings. Steelman Partners, a renowned architectural firm based out of Las Vegas, has designed the new look for THE HOTEL.

The new exterior design of THE HOTEL will combine a sleek, modern look with the natural scenic beauty of Tuolumne. This update will also connect THE HOTEL to the gaming area and create a grand, dramatic new lobby that will serve as the main shared entrance to both buildings.

One of the two new pools will be just for adults and include a pool bar, a brand-new larger hot tub, a massive outdoor television screen to enjoy all the big games, and a stage for live music. The other will be designed for children to beat the heat with a splash zone, slides, and various other water features. This will complement the recently opened Elevate jump center that features trampoline jumping, dodgeball, a Junior Jump Zone for small children, a Ninja Course, axe throwing, several multi-sport simulator screens, and much more to keep children and adults of all ages active and entertained.

About Black Oak Casino Resort

Located in Tuolumne, Calif. in the scenic Sierra Nevada foothills, Black Oak Casino Resort is owned and operated by The Tuolumne Band of Me-Wuk Indians. The resort encompasses 164,770 square feet of entertainment, including 1,100 slot machines, 22 table games, and high-limit and smoke-free gaming. Guests can enjoy casual and upscale dining, plus full bars with craft beer and cocktails, live entertainment, and 24-lane bowling alley. THE HOTEL features 148 luxury rooms and a full-service conference and event center. The RV Park offers 85 full-hookup sites, plus a clubhouse with pool and spa. blackoakcasino.com
